首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将javascript的变量存储在另一个.js文件中?

将JavaScript的变量存储在另一个.js文件中可以通过以下几种方式实现:

  1. 使用全局变量:在一个.js文件中声明变量,然后在另一个.js文件中引用该变量即可。全局变量在整个应用程序中都可以访问。
  2. 使用模块化机制:使用ES6的模块化语法(import和export)或者其他模块化工具(如RequireJS、CommonJS)将变量封装在一个模块中,然后在另一个.js文件中导入该模块并使用其中的变量。
  3. 使用LocalStorage或SessionStorage:LocalStorage和SessionStorage是浏览器提供的API,用于在浏览器本地存储数据。你可以将变量值存储在LocalStorage或SessionStorage中,在另一个.js文件中从中读取该值。

下面是对每种方式的详细解释:

  1. 全局变量:
    • 概念:全局变量是在整个应用程序中都可以访问的变量,它在声明的位置之后的任何地方都可以使用。
    • 优势:全局变量简单易用,可以方便地在多个.js文件中共享数据。
    • 应用场景:适用于需要在多个.js文件中共享数据的情况。
    • 相关产品和链接:腾讯云无相关产品。
  • 模块化机制:
    • 概念:模块化是一种将代码封装成独立、可复用的模块的方法,不同模块之间可以通过导入和导出来共享数据。
    • 优势:模块化使得代码更加清晰、可维护,可以避免全局命名冲突,提高代码的复用性。
    • 应用场景:适用于大型项目或多人协作的项目,可以将不同功能的代码分解成多个模块进行开发和管理。
    • 相关产品和链接:腾讯云无相关产品。
  • LocalStorage或SessionStorage:
    • 概念:LocalStorage和SessionStorage是浏览器提供的API,用于在浏览器本地存储数据。
    • 优势:LocalStorage和SessionStorage可以将数据存储在用户的浏览器中,可以长期保存(LocalStorage)或仅在会话期间保存(SessionStorage),并且可以在不同页面之间共享数据。
    • 应用场景:适用于需要在浏览器中保存和共享数据的场景,如用户登录信息、用户偏好设置等。
    • 相关产品和链接:腾讯云无相关产品。

以上是将JavaScript的变量存储在另一个.js文件中的几种方式,根据具体情况选择合适的方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券